PESHAWAR: Deputy Speaker of the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Assembly Suriya Bibi held an emergency meeting with the secretary and chief engineer of the Communication and Works (C&W) Department as people of Torkhow started another protest with a march to Booni over the Booni-Buzund road project.
The Torkhow and Terich Road Forum (TTRF), has arranged the protest and participants are marching towards Booni.
The protesters alleged advance payments to contractor of the project work on which has again been halted.
The deputy commissioner of Upper Chitral was also called to attend the meeting. During the meeting, Suriya Bibi expressed strong dissatisfaction and informed the officials about the public allegations.
She later issued written instructions to the secretary C&W to form a committee within three days. The committee will include elders from the Torkhow-Terich area, C&W officials, district officers and construction experts.
The committee will review all past and current payments and look into any irregularities. A report will be prepared and shared with the public.
If anyone is found responsible, legal action will be taken, she added.
However, the protesters rejected the committee and called for a judicial inquiry into the allegations saying they would present evidence of corruption in the project.
It may be mentioned here that the project to construct the Booni-Buzund road was launched about 16 years ago and so far not even half of the 30 km road has been completed.
Locals say that the government has released 1.25 billion rupees for the project so far, but the project is plagued with of corruption and irregularities.
